Microsoft Azure Solutions Architect Expert AZ-305 Practice Question

Your company has 50 Azure subscriptions organized under a single management-group hierarchy. All Azure Activity logs and resource diagnostic logs must be collected centrally. Security requires interactive Kusto queries for the most recent 90 days of data and the ability to retain and query all raw log data for at least three years at minimal cost. The design must also make it easy to onboard future subscriptions. What should you recommend?

  • Configure an Azure Storage account in every subscription, stream all logs to the account, and move blobs to Cool tier with lifecycle rules for three-year retention.

  • Create a dedicated Log Analytics workspace in a central subscription. Use diagnostic settings on each subscription to send Activity and resource logs to the workspace, set workspace retention to 90 days, and enable the Azure Monitor archive tier for three-year retention.

  • Enable an Azure Monitor Private Link Scope in each subscription and use Azure Monitor workbooks to aggregate queries, relying on the default 365-day log retention.

  • Deploy a single Event Hubs namespace at the root management group, stream logs from all subscriptions, and use Azure Stream Analytics to write the data to an Azure SQL Database that has three-year point-in-time restore configured.
